Set Up a Classification System for Optimal Junk Removal
An efficient sorting system is essential for simplifying the junk removal process. By grouping items, individuals can more easily figure out what to keep, donate, recycle, or discard. The first step involves gathering containers or bags labeled for each category. This visual aid helps in maintaining focus during the sorting activity.
After this, individuals should carefully handle each section, placing items into their corresponding containers as they work. It is wise to be truthful about the necessity of each item, asking whether it provides value or joy. Maintaining a timer can also increase productivity, encouraging prompt decisions and decreasing second-guessing.
When sorting is finished, the next step is to transfer items from the designated containers to their final destinations. This systematic approach not only simplifies the junk removal process but also fosters a sense of accomplishment, ultimately resulting in a more tidy and serene living space.

Collect Your Necessary Decluttering Tools
While starting on a decluttering journey, having the right tools on hand can considerably improve the process. Essential tools include sturdy boxes or bins for sorting items into categories such as keep, donate, and discard. Labeling materials, for example markers and adhesive labels, help make certain that each box is easily identifiable, expediting the decision-making process. A tape measure can also be valuable for determining if larger items fit into designated spaces.
In addition, garbage bags are essential for quickly disposing of unwanted items. For items that call for special handling, such as electronics or hazardous materials, it's essential to have a plan and appropriate containers. Lastly, a notebook or digital app can assist in tracking progress and jotting down observations regarding future organization. By equipping oneself with these key decluttering tools, the journey toward a tidier and clutter-free space becomes noticeably more manageable.
Guidelines for Long-Term Organization After Clearing Out
Establishing lasting order after decluttering necessitates consistent habits and thoughtful planning. To keep an organized space, individuals should adopt a routine for consistent tidying. This can include designating a particular time each week to assess belongings and return items to their proper places.
Making use of storage solutions, such as bins or shelves, can also aid in organize items categorized and easily accessible. Labeling these storage containers guarantees clarity, making it less difficult to discover necessary items without searching through clutter.
Furthermore, establishing a one-in-one-out strategy can halt future accumulation. This means that for every new item entering the home, an old item should be discarded.
In conclusion, consistently reevaluating one's space and belongings can aid in recognizing any new clutter and resolve it immediately, fostering a sustainable organizational system. By following these tips, individuals can maintain a clutter-free environment for the long term.

Dangerous Materials Management
Handling hazardous materials requires expertise and careful consideration, as inadequate disposal methods can pose significant health and safety risks. Items such as batteries, paints, chemicals, and electronic waste contain substances that can damage the environment and human health if not dealt with appropriately. It is vital for individuals to identify when these materials are present and access now to understand the legal regulations related to their disposal. In cases involving hazardous waste, engaging professional junk removal services is highly recommended. These experts are qualified to safely manage and dispose of hazardous materials in accordance with local laws. By engaging experts, individuals can guarantee their space is decluttered without jeopardizing safety or the environment.

How Do I Recycle E-Waste the Right Way?
To recycle electronic waste properly, you should find certified e-waste recycling centers, comply with local regulations, and ensure devices are cleared of personal data before disposal. This promotes environmental sustainability and reduces harmful landfill impact.

Am I Able to Donate Items That Are Broken or Damaged?
Contributing broken or damaged items is generally not recommended, as the majority of organizations want functional goods. That said, some charities may accept them for refurbishing or recycling. It's best to inquire directly with the particular organization before donating.
